Merino's stoppage-time goal sends Spain into World Cup quarter-finals
Spain defeated Portugal 1-0 in a tense World Cup round-of-16 clash. Mikel Merino scored the only goal deep into stoppage time to seal the narrow victory. Goalkeeper Unai Simon was instrumental, delivering a commanding performance to keep a clean sheet. The result ends Portugal's tournament run and marks what appears to be the conclusion of Cristiano Ronaldo's World Cup career. With the win, Spain advance to the quarter-finals for the first time since their 2010 title-winning campaign.
